Gas turbine
A stationary gas turbine. - Gas turbines, also called combustion turbines, are used in a broad scope of applications including electric power generation, cogeneration, natural gas transmission, and various process applications. - An annular combustor is a doughnut-shaped, single, continuous chamber that encircles the turbine in a plane perpendicular to the air flow. Can-annular combustors are similar to the annular;however, they incorporate several can-shaped combustion chambers rather than a single continuous chamber.

Many small stationary gas turbine engines have been built over the last 50 years or so, these engines may be considered collectable in a similar way to their reciprocating brothers. - The rich and complex sound of a spooling turbine cannot be compared to any other power plant. - These engines are the most common form of gas turbine a subset of which are APUs or stationary small power plants, it is this type of engine which is the main focus of this website.
The Rover 1S60 gas turbine engine is probably the classic British stationary engine. - Found as many applications, it is a unique power plant which attempted to take the place of reciprocating engines. The Rover like many other small engines began life in the 1950s when turbines were seen as a viable alternative to piston engines. Rover developed gas turbines for automotive use and also the cold war fuelled development of small stationary units. - Turbine.
Work on a gas turbine engine was started in April 1952 in the East Research building which was were the aero engines use to be tested after been built in the underground tunnels. - Just a couple of years later Dr Weaving had to recognise that gas turbines were fine for aircraft but were impractical for cars, and actually in the 1970s were tried again in a Leyland lorry but this too was soon abandoned. The main problems was the amount of heat generated which has to be dealt with. - Gas Turbine Stationary Engine.

A gas turbine stationary vane having an airfoil portion and inner and outer shrouds. Five serpentine radially extending cooling air passages are formed in the vane. - Abstract: A gas turbine stationary vane having an airfoil portion and inner and outer shrouds. Five serpentine radially extending cooling air passages are formed in the vane airfoil. The first passage is disposed adjacent the leading edge of the airfoil and the second passage is disposed adjacent the trailing edge.
